Cayon’s Water Problem Sees Remarkable Improvement with the Government of St. Kitts and Nevis!

After enduring prolonged water scarcity for over 7 years, the Cayon community can finally breathe a sigh of relief. Thanks to the dedicated efforts of the new administration under Drew’s leadership, significant headway has been made in tackling this pressing issue within just a year.

The collaboration with drilling company ‘BEAD’ has yielded remarkable results, not only resolving the immediate water crisis but also fostering renewed optimism. The positive outcomes extend beyond Cayon, benefitting neighboring villages like Keys, Ottley’s, and St Peter.
